Don't setup paged query in coroutine

pull/1067/head
Alex Baker 4 years ago
parent 2aee8683d3
commit d124fc1e64

@ -55,13 +55,13 @@ class TaskListViewModel @ViewModelInject constructor(
return
}
try {
viewModelScope.launch(Dispatchers.Default) {
val subtasks = taskDao.getSubtaskInfo()
if (manualSortFilter || !preferences.usePagedQueries()) {
if (manualSortFilter || !preferences.usePagedQueries()) {
viewModelScope.launch(Dispatchers.Default) {
val subtasks = taskDao.getSubtaskInfo()
performNonPagedQuery(subtasks)
} else {
performPagedListQuery()
}
} else {
performPagedListQuery()
}
} catch (e: Exception) {
Timber.e(e)

Loading…
Cancel
Save